Passenger's Seat Dispute Sparks Outrage on Flight

A recent flight to Kolkata became a scene of disruption when a female passenger refused her assigned middle seat, citing discomfort sitting between two men. Comedian Abhijit Ganguly, who was on the flight, recounted the incident on X, describing the passenger's behavior as entitled. She initially asked passengers in the aisle and window seats to swap, and when they refused, she summoned cabin crew to arrange a different seat.

The passenger's demands caused inconvenience, leading to a debate online about passenger rights and acceptable behavior. Some social media users supported her request, emphasizing personal comfort and the right to refuse seating arrangements. However, many others criticized her actions, deeming them unreasonable and disruptive to the flight experience.

This incident sparked discussions about airline policies on seat assignments and passenger conduct during flights. While the man in the window seat eventually exchanged his seat to de-escalate the situation, the episode raised questions about entitlement and the responsibilities of passengers and crew in resolving such disputes.
